Monster: job vacancies up in April

The number of jobs advertised in Sweden rose in April for the third month running, according to the Monster Employment Index. The number of vacancies was up 17 percent on April last year.

Growth was strongest in the building sector year-on-year. Management and consultancy jobs saw the biggest month-on-month rise.

The March index, compiled by the online recruitment giant from a survey of 148 European job websites, shows the number of job advertisements rising across all sectors last month.

“The Swedish jobs market is recovering quickly. The number of ob advertisements has risen for the third month running. Sweden has had the strongest annual growth in job ads of all the countries covered by the index,” said Carl Silverstolpe of Monster Scandinavia.
